Was also wondering how a 720 would push around this XP since it's for my wife and she won't need much...can it be done? it's the cheaper rout, and I'm all about pinching pennies [emoji108] much to the chagrin of a few of yall [emoji14] just a thought
 
720 will power if fine but will be more expensive and a bigger PITA. Motor mounts in the hull are different and you will need all the electronics for the 720 too. Easiest bet is a rebuilt 787.
 
Or better yet $400 exchange right here and I give you a good running used one. You will still have to do the fuel system. Just make sure the electronics are good so it's worth it.
 
This came from a 97XP also so it has the correct PTO for your drive shaft and everything. It really is "plug n play" but you should throw a coat of paint on it while it's out.
